Kirkwood Mountain Resort Properties offers ski shuttles for downhill runs. Guests can dine at two on-site restaurants and relax by the lobby fireplace. The resort supports mountain biking and snowboarding, with amenities like a gym and business center.
Located in Kirkwood, Kirkwood Mountain Resort by Vail Resorts is in a rural area and in the mountains. Kirkwood Mountain Resort and Cornice Express Ski Lift are worth checking out if an activity is on the agenda, while those wishing to experience the area's natural beauty can explore Jim Quinn Spring and Grover Hot Springs State Park. A grocery/convenience store, a fireplace in the lobby, and a bar are just a few of the amenities provided at Kirkwood Mountain Resort by Vail Resorts. Hit the slopes at this hotel offering a free ski shuttle, downhill skiing, and cross-country skiing. At the two on-site restaurants, enjoy breakfast, brunch, lunch, dinner, and American cuisine. Enjoy the gym, as well as activities like snowshoeing, snowboarding, and snow tubing. In addition to a business center, guests can connect to free in-room WiFi, with speed of 25+ Mbps.
